WAVE
F.C. sets December events
DESTIN,
Florida -- Area youngsters can get an extra kick out
of the holiday season with a pair of events scheduled
by the WAVE Futebol Club.
In
cooperation with the Fort Walton Beach Recreational
Department, WAVE F.C. will host its 2000 Soccer
Jamboree on Saturday, December 9. The first of
planned annual jamborees, the event is open to all
youngsters ages 8 - 14 shooting for goals of playing
good soccer, practicing good sportsmanship and having
a good time. Registration is at 8 a.m. on
December 9, with the jamboree kicking off at 9 a.m.
The event will be held at the Oakland Soccer Complex,
behind the Fort Walton Beach Home Depot. Cost is
$5 per participant. Current WAVE F.C. members
will be admitted free wearing their team T-shirt and
with a friend not presently a WAVE member. All
participants should bring cleats, ball, shinguards and
plenty of water.
Professional-level
soccer instruction comes home for the holidays this
year with WAVE F.C.'s Christmas Soccer Camp on
December 26-29. Youngsters ages 6-15 can sharpen
their skills at half-day sessions (9 a.m. - noon or 1
- 4 p.m.) or full-day sessions under the instruction
of the camp staff including Roberto Perez, former
professional South American and European soccer
player, and Carlos Henrique, Brazilian professional
soccer player. The camp will be held at Destin
Middle School on Danny Wuerffel Way. Cost is $95
for half-day and $145 for full-day sessions.
All
campers should wear proper soccer attire, including
shinguards and cleats, and bring a ball and plenty of
drinking water. All-day campers should bring
lunch. Among skills to be covered are ball
control, shooting, dribbling, passing, team play and
technique, strategy, good sportsmanship -- and fun!
